由于底层的 TCP 无法理解上层的业务数据, 所以在底层是无法保证数据包不被拆分和重 组的, 这个问题只能通过上层的应用协议栈设计来解决, 根据业界的主流协议的解决方案, 可以归纳如下。 (1) 在包尾增加分割符, 比如回车换行符进行分割, 例如 FTP 协议; (2) 消息定长, 例如每个报文的大小为固定长度 200 字节, 如果不够, 空位补空格;
2023-03-26 15:39:43 9KB netty java
1
智慧城市解决方案南京亿图信息科技有限公司物联网应用产业本部智慧农业一建设之源二建设之本三建设之道五建设之力四建设之行一智慧农业——建设之源一智慧农业——建设之源二智慧农业——建设之本三智慧农业——建设
2023-03-26 13:23:40 1001KB 农业
1
matlabReact扩散代码React流CFD Matlab(R)和C ++中的代码集,用于解决“React流的计算流体动力学”课程(Politecnico di Milano)中介绍和讨论的基本问题 1.用有限差分(FD)方法进行一维对流扩散方程 对流扩散方程是使用有限差分法在一维域上求解的。 假定常数,均匀速度和扩散系数。 时间离散化采用正向(或显式)欧拉方法,而空间二阶导数则采用二阶居中方案进行离散化。 Matlab脚本: Matlab实时脚本: 2.二维有限差分法(FD)的对流扩散方程 对流扩散方程使用有限差分法在二维矩形域上求解。 假定恒定,均匀的速度分量和扩散系数。 时间离散化采用正向(或显式)欧拉方法,而空间二阶导数则采用二阶居中方案进行离散化。 Matlab脚本: Matlab实时脚本: 3.二维泊松方程 使用有限差分法在二维矩形域上求解泊松方程。 最初采用常数源术语。 使用二阶居中方案离散化空间导数。 采用不同的方法求解方程:Jacobi方法,Gauss-Siedler方法和连续过度松弛(SOR)方法 Matlab脚本: Matlab实时脚本: 通过显式组装与空间离
2023-03-26 09:59:45 1.08MB 系统开源
1
解决在弹出输入法时,布局被遮挡的问题,如果觉得还不错的话,给个好评呗。(*^_^*)
2023-03-25 22:57:11 240KB android 输入法 键盘 遮挡
1
算法课实验、大作业
2023-03-25 14:18:55 3KB 复制即可跑 代码规范
1
OSError: [Errno 22] Invalid argument问题解决问题描述解决方法那么问题出在哪了?总结 问题描述 在做SSD目标检测算法的时候,在predict.py文件中遇到了这么一个报错的问题。 // ERROR Traceback (most recent call last): File "D:/ssd-keras-fromCSDN-Parathyoid/predict.py", line 7, in image = Image.open("‪C:\Users\qw\Desktop\000000.jpg") File "D:\anaconda\envs\
2023-03-25 10:17:16 81KB al ali ar
1
人工智能-CSP最小冲突法解决n皇后问题,(中国地质大学,计算机学院~~)
2023-03-24 22:10:35 415KB 最小冲突法
1
分布式事务解决方案「手写代码」,完整版视频教程下载。 课程大纲 1.基础概念:了解事务的ACID、CAP理论、BASE理论,为分布式方案打基础 2.2PC/3PC:通过2PC演化各种方案:XA方案、JTA、LCN、Seata 3.TCC:TCC不依赖本地事务的解决方案 4.可靠消息最终一致性:唯有了解方案原理,方能熟悉RocketMQ的事务消息 5.最大努力通知:原来微信支付、支付宝的支付成功是这样的原理
2023-03-24 21:32:01 789B java 分布式 TCC
1
前言 最近这两天登陆服务器,发现用 wget 下载文件的时候提示“No space left on device”,而且连使用 tab 键进行补全时也会提示该错误。 之前遇到过一次这种问题,是由于磁盘空间被占满了,导致无法创建新文件。正常情况下,删除一些文件来释放空间,即可解决该问题。 当我使用 df 命令查看分区情况时,结果如下: # df -h Filesystem Size Used Avail Use% Mounted on /dev/vda1 29G 29G 0 100% / udev 10M 0 10M 0% /dev tmpfs 101M 232K 100M 1% /run
2023-03-24 19:11:51 62KB ace c ce
1
前言 最近遇到一个问题,在一个页面需要动态渲染页面内的表单,其中包括 checkbox 表单类型,并且使用 Element 组件 UI 时,此时 v-model 绑定的数据也是动态生成的 例如: 定义的 data 的 form 里面是空对象,需要动态生成里面的 key export default { data() { return { form: {} } }, } 从后端接口得到 checkList,这个就是动态生成的表单数据 v-for 循环 checkList,得到 key,然后直接 v-model=“form.key” 动态生成 form 里面的 key <el-
2023-03-23 23:15:31 46KB box c check
1